Spending addiction
Stuff and more stuff:
We buy too much junk, it's that simple. Money is tight? STOP BUYING STUFF!
American society is the richest in the history of mankind. And the evidence of our wealth is perhaps easiest to see in rampant consumerism: there are twice as many shopping centers as high schools, the average American uses 12,000 shopping bags in a lifetime, and 160,000 TV and computers are discarded everyday.
